  1. In the short term yes. In the long run no. You will likely even save money. Don't count on your insurance to cover much of the cost. The other alternative for replacing a missing tooth is a bridge or removable partial denture. Most people don't go for the removable type and get a fixed or cemented bridge. But they don't last forever and if you are young you will like have to have it replaced several times in your life. An implant could last you the rest of your life if you take care of it and have it placed and restored by a competent surgeon/dentist. I would have to say the cost would be in the range of $3500 to $4800 depending on who does it, what area you live in, and the complexity of your case. If you can do it, get the implant because it will save the teeth on either side of the space from needing to be ground down to place a fixed bridge.
